问题标签 [olsmultiplelinearregression]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- 当 OLS 连接变量时引发 NumberFormatException
我正在尝试运行 OLS 回归,代码工作正常,但将变量连接成一个例外。我试图调查可能是什么问题,但我无法找到原因
它抛出以下错误
从我可以阅读的内容来看,它似乎是连接这些值而不是一个接一个地读取。
python-3.x - 在多元线性回归中打印预测值时出错
这适用于简单的线性回归,但这里不适用于多元线性回归
r - 如何解释数据的线性回归假设
我有一个包含 3719 个观察值的数据集,有 9 个特征。我已经使用选定的特征执行了多元线性回归。我得到了这样的诊断图:
我通过绘图了解到因变量和自变量之间没有线性关系。残差图给出非线性趋势。但从正态 QQ 图中,它遵循正态分布。我没有得到残差与杠杆图的含义是什么?
我理解正确吗?如何解释这些情节。
statsmodels - 如何使用 statsmodels.api 使用 OSL 拟合模型
以下是udemy课程的代码:- 我尝试了堆栈溢出中提供的所有解决方案,但似乎没有任何效果
(以前在社区提供的解决方案都不起作用)
我收到一条错误消息:-
python - 线性回归和生成数据 =+
我在 Jupiter 笔记本中遇到了使用 python 编码的问题。这个问题是关于线性回归的。如下:
1:线性回归 在本笔记本中,我们将从线性函数生成数据:=+,然后使用 OLS(普通最小二乘法)和梯度下降求解 ̂。
问题 1.1:生成数据:=+ 这里我们假设 ≈(,)=+ 其中与加性噪声成线性关系 您的函数应具有以下属性:
输出 y 作为形状为 (M,1) 的 np.array generate_linear_y 应该适用于任意 x、b 和 eps,只要它们是适当的尺寸,不要使用 for 循环分别计算每个 y[i],因为这对于大型 M 和 N 来说会非常慢。相反,您应该利用 numpy 线性代数。
他们希望我们编写如下代码:
有人可以帮助我,因为我完全糊涂了!我什至没有意识到我正在做的事情需要在 python 中进行数组编码,而我一直在努力解决这个问题!请帮忙!
python - 值错误:多元线性回归模型中的形状未对齐
我正在尝试使用 Sklearn 的线性回归和 statsmodels.api 来构建线性模型。
方法是删除 p 值和 VIF 值高于标准的变量(p 值:0.05,VIF:<5)
bike_train 列是 8 月、12 月、2 月、1 月、7 月、6 月、3 月、5 月、11 月、10 月、9 月、周一、周六、周日、周四、周二、周三、小雪和雨、薄雾和多云、春季、夏季、冬天,温度,湿度,风速,bike_count
输出 :
型号 1
型号 2
模型 3
模型 4
型号 5
型号 6
错误 :
在创建模型之前缩放所有数值,如下所示:
请告诉我我哪里做错了,提前谢谢!!
python - 我可以使用 numpy.polyfit(x, y, deg) 进行多元线性回归吗
有什么方法可以在 numpy.polyfit() 中拟合两个自变量和一个因变量?
我有一个从 csv 文件加载的熊猫数据框。我希望将两列作为自变量包含在内,以使用 NumPy 运行多元线性回归。
目前我的简单线性回归如下所示:
model_combined = np.polyfit(data.Exercise, y, 1)
我也希望包含data.Age
在 x 中。
python - I() 等价物(在 R 中使用),Python 等价物是什么?
R 中的 I() 函数用于在线性回归中创建新的预测变量,例如 X^2:
这里给出了一个很好的解释(R线性回归公式中的大写字母“I”是什么意思?)。
我正在尝试使用相同的公式在 Python 中进行线性回归,但我似乎找不到等价的。此代码适用于单个变量
但是如果我尝试下面的代码片段,它显然不能正常工作。
尝试 ^ 运算符也没有意义,因为 Python 将此符号解释为按位异或。有谁知道在 Python 中是否有相同的函数 I() 的等价物?
python - Python:如何加载 CSV 文件并从中提取特定列以用作数据输入?
我有一个 CSV 文件,其中每一行都是一个病人,每一列都是一个“特征”。我想使用这个多元线性回归代码。而不是波士顿示例数据集,我想加载我的 CSV 文件并使用第 1 到 79 列作为“数据”特征矩阵 (X),第 80 列作为“目标”响应向量 (y)。我怎样才能做到这一点?我对 Python 很陌生,因此非常感谢任何建议。